Research reveals potential of TLS in improving glioma treatment outcomes.
― 4 min read
Cutting edge science explained simply
Research reveals potential of TLS in improving glioma treatment outcomes.
― 4 min read
Discover how HLA genes shape our immune system and cancer treatments.
― 6 min read